Here's a new piece from this weekend:
This is a personal favorite. About a year or two ago I bought a large lot of second hand BattleMechs from a local gaming store. Among the lot were a few LAM odds and ends, but nothing to make a complete miniature (The closest was a Phoenix Hawk, sans "boosters" and with a broken main gun). Since everything was beat to hell, I figured this would be a great opportunity to do some kit bashing. The new "boosters" are off the reseen Phoenix Hawk, and I added odds and ends that I'd picked up over the years. In the lot were a couple Phoenix Hawk BattleMechs, one of which I modified into a complementary "'Mech mode" mini. The 'mech is painted in a scheme I use for my Amphigean aerospace fighters (ground camo on top, three shades of blue on the underside.
My head-canon: Amphigean Agriculture Inc. salvaged a badly damaged Phoenix Hawk LAM in the 3020s, and enlisted LexaTech and GTK enterpises to refurbish the machine. The LAM required vast modification before it could be restored to flying status. It was fitted with equipment that would later appear on late-model Phoenix Hawks, and the avionics and control surfaces needed to be totally revised. The 'Mech was treated as a "floater", attached to Amphigean Light Assault Groups when needed, until Operation: Bulldog, when it was permanently attached to the 1st Amphigean LAG. Ultimately, the machine survived Bulldog. Structurally fatigued and beyond repair with the destruction of LexaTech's LAM factory, the machine was retired and became a museum piece at Amphigean's corporate HQ.
